Welcome 1st Time Attendees, New Members and Veterans of NAPO!
You don’t want to miss this fun and engaging opening conference event! You’ll hear from NAPO Leadership, and learn about all the great things happening at NAPO and how to get the most out of your Virtual Annual Conference experience.

You’ll also be able to network, get all your specific questions answered, and receive detailed information on NAPO Education, volunteering, POINT, and more. Come see what NAPO is all about and hear the Top Ten Tips for getting the most out of the NAPO Annual Conference. This is a must attend event - we'll see you there!

Led by Sara Genrich

 

 

Sara Genrich is the proud owner of Configuration Connection and co-owner of Productivity Training Academy. She is currently serving at the NAPO Membership Committee Chair, and will transition to a Member Director position on the NAPO Board in May. She has been a member of NAPO and NAPO-DFW for 10 years and is a former NAPO-DFW board member who served as the Communications and Technology Director for 3 years. She previously served as co-leader for the Business Organizing & Productivity SIG, and on the NAPO Statistics Database and Foresight committees. Sara has been an Evernote Certified Consultant since 2014. She is the creator of the Organizing@Work Workshop. She started Configuration Connection to help businesses and busy professionals successfully configure their time, information and space. She has over 20 years of experience in various office settings and industries. Sara is a mother of 2 daughters, and a wife who enjoys traveling, reading and wine. She volunteers in her community with Creekwood UMC, Habitat for Humanity and Family Promise.
